  • @heavenwardbound Sort of. I just got of the shower that is why my face looks that way. Give it a few more hours and you wouldn't have said anything,lol. Anyways, my face got bad again so I had to get serious with my regimen again. So was with cleanser, toner, gentle scrub, and then aveeno product with sunscreen. At night cleanser,toner, and then organic aloe vera--in the morning skin is baby soft. Also, half way through the day if my face gets too oily I will use my toner to control the oil.
